Understanding Your Fitness Goals
Before delving into the world of fitness apps, it's crucial to have a clear understanding of your fitness goals. Are you looking to lose weight, build muscle, improve flexibility, or simply stay active? Identifying your objectives will narrow down your search for the right app that aligns with your specific goals. Some apps specialize in cardio workouts, while others focus on strength training or yoga. Knowing what you want to achieve will help you choose an app that provides tailored workouts to meet your needs.
Assessing App Features and Functionality
Once you've identified your fitness goals, it's essential to assess the features and functionality of different fitness apps. Look for apps that offer diverse workout routines, customizable workout plans, progress tracking tools, and motivational features such as challenges or rewards. Consider whether you prefer guided workouts with audio or video instructions, the option to workout with a virtual trainer, or the flexibility to create your workouts. Additionally, check if the app integrates with wearable devices or allows you to sync your workouts with other fitness platforms for a comprehensive wellness experience.
Researching User Reviews and Recommendations
Reading user reviews and seeking recommendations from friends or fitness professionals can provide valuable insights into the effectiveness and user experience of various fitness apps. Look for reviews that highlight the app's user-friendliness, workout variety, effectiveness in achieving fitness goals, and customer support quality. Pay attention to feedback about app updates, bugs, or glitches that may affect your overall experience. By researching user reviews and recommendations, you can gain a better understanding of how each app performs in real-world scenarios and make an informed decision.
